The Pentagon on Monday night revealed that eight targets in Yemen had been hit by joint U.S.-U.K. airstrikes, saying the sites were chosen to 'degrade Houthi capability to continue their reckless and unlawful attacks on U.S. and U.K. ships as well as international commercial shipping.'The United States and British forces carried out a second round of strikes against Houthi targets in Yemen on Monday - the latest move against the Iran-aligned group over its targeting of Red Sea shipping.The attacks were the eighth launched by the U.S., but only the second joint effort. The first joint strikes were on January 11.
